- 2026-08-14 Core Scientific Completes Acquisition of Polaris DS, Advancing Planned Muskogee Expansion to 1.5 GW of Gross Power MIAMI--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Core Scientific, Inc. (Nasdaq: CORZ) (“Core Scientific” or the “Company”), a leader in digital infrastructure for high-density colocation (“HDC”), today announced that it has completed its previously announced acquisition of Polaris DS LLC (“Polaris”). Through the acquisition, Core Scientific has secured the approximately 440 currently in service megawatts (“MW”) of gross, grid-connected power capacity being used by Polaris under existing electric service agreements with.

- 2026-08-07 Core Scientific: A Growth Story Behind Colocation Moat Core Scientific is rated Buy, driven by robust colocation revenue and strong execution in a rapidly expanding AI-driven market. The company''s colocation business, accounting for over 80% of revenue, is underpinned by long-term contracts like AMD and CoreWeave, offering diversification and high profit margins. Revenue and EBITDA trends are positive, with FY2026 revenue estimated at $671.63 million (110.53% YoY growth) and EBITDA projected to reach $194.08 million by FY2028.
